Yosemite Popup Buttons, Recessed & Borderless hover display is white

Originator:peter
Number:rdar://18376252 Date Originated:2014-09-18
Status:Open Resolved:
Product:OS X Product Version:Yosemite since DP8
Classification: Reproducible:Always
 
In Yosemite since DP8 (regression from all previous versions), Popup Buttons that are Recessed & Borderless display the text in white when hovered.  But without the background (as properly not changed because borderless is off), the white text is unreadable (indeed, in my window, which has a white background, the button simply disappears when you hover over it).

Steps to Reproduce:
Create a new project.
Create a popup button
Change it to Recessed
Change it to Borderless
Run - hover over button, button disappears (well, nearly disappears because the default window color is a light gray and the text is white).

Expected Results:
In Borderless mode, the text should not change color (or the change should be more subtle, to black or a lighter but still dark grey).

Actual Results:
Since DP8, the button simply disappears when you hover over it, a terrible regression.

Comments


Please note: Reports posted here will not necessarily be seen by Apple. All problems should be submitted at bugreport.apple.com before they are posted here. Please only post information for Radars that you have filed yourself, and please do not include Apple confidential information in your posts. Thank you!